Transaction 2595b31c7602101629fbedb9e72023139ccdf7f3bfae23534ae91a76f9eb938a

1 Input
2 Outputs
  • 2595b31c7602101629fbedb9e72023139ccdf7f3bfae23534ae91a76f9eb938a:0
  • value  89469
    address  122Nqhm2AxbcVaKBrADNtQs8yd5w3BAAdm
  • 2595b31c7602101629fbedb9e72023139ccdf7f3bfae23534ae91a76f9eb938a:1
  • value  23600
    address  1KiVreYUJsDVHdmNAysiz8ysJsv9Q14YCQ